norm.m

来自「张量分析工具」· M 代码 · 共 32 行

M
32
字号
function nrm = norm(A)%NORM Frobenius norm of a ktensor.%%   NORM(T) returns the Frobenius norm of a ktensor.%%   See also KTENSOR.%%MATLAB Tensor Toolbox.%Copyright 2007, Sandia Corporation. % This is the MATLAB Tensor Toolbox by Brett Bader and Tamara Kolda. % http://csmr.ca.sandia.gov/~tgkolda/TensorToolbox.% Copyright (2007) Sandia Corporation. Under the terms of Contract% DE-AC04-94AL85000, there is a non-exclusive license for use of this% work by or on behalf of the U.S. Government. Export of this data may% require a license from the United States Government.% The full license terms can be found in tensor_toolbox/LICENSE.txt% $Id: norm.m,v 1.8 2007/01/10 01:27:30 bwbader Exp $% Retrieve the factors of AU = A.u;% Compute the matrix of correlation coefficientscoefMatrix = A.lambda * A.lambda';for i = 1:ndims(A)  coefMatrix = coefMatrix .* (U{i}'*U{i});endnrm = sqrt(sum(coefMatrix(:)));return;

⌨️ 快捷键说明

复制代码Ctrl + C
搜索代码Ctrl + F
全屏模式F11
增大字号Ctrl + =
减小字号Ctrl + -
显示快捷键?